PLC Controller - A Must-Have for Industrial Automation

In the world of industrial automation, the PLC controller is often seen as a must-have. This device allows for precise and efficient control over various processes, making it crucial in ensuring smooth and reliable operations.The PLC controller's key function is to process and analyze data from sensors, relays, and other devices within the industrial environment. With its advanced algorithms and programming capabilities, the PLC can make decisions based on these inputs and adjust parameters accordingly.One of the most notable benefits of using a PLC controller for industrial automation is its ability to reduce downtime. By providing real-time monitoring and adjustments, the PLC can quickly identify issues and take corrective action, minimizing any disruption to the production line.Another important aspect of the PLC controller is its flexibility. It can be customized to suit specific needs, whether that be controlling multiple machines simultaneously or integrating with other systems like SCADA.Overall, the PLC controller is a powerful tool for anyone looking to streamline their industrial processes and enhance efficiency. Its advanced features and reliability make it an essential component for any modern manufacturing facility.

What is a PLC Controller?

A PLC (Programmable Logic Controller) is a vital component in industrial automation. It's a digital computer designed to monitor and control machines or processes. PLC controllers are widely used in various industries such as manufacturing, energy, water treatment, and many more.

Types of PLC Controller Models

There are several types of PLC controller models available in the market, each designed for specific applications. Here are some of the most common types:

1、Compact PLC Controllers: These are small-sized PLCs suitable for simple applications. They are easy to program and offer cost-effective solutions for small-scale operations.

2、Modular PLC Controllers: These are more advanced and flexible systems that consist of various modules. They are suitable for complex applications that require high-performance features and scalability.

PLC Controller - A Must-Have for Industrial Automation

3、Distributed PLC Controllers: These are designed for large-scale systems where multiple controllers are connected via a network. They provide efficient data management and communication capabilities.

4、Specialty PLC Controllers: These are tailored to specific industries or applications, such as food processing, packaging, or robotics. They come with specialized features and functions to meet specific requirements.

How to Choose the Right PLC Controller Model?

Choosing the right PLC controller model for your business can be challenging, but with careful consideration of your needs, you can make the right decision. Here are some factors to consider:

1、Application Requirements: Identify the specific tasks and processes you want to automate. This will help you determine the type of PLC controller you need for your application.

2、Scalability and Flexibility: Consider the growth potential of your business and choose a PLC controller that can accommodate future expansion. Look for systems that offer scalability and flexibility to meet changing requirements.

3、Cost: Consider your budget and compare the costs of different PLC controller models. While cost is important, don't compromise on quality and performance.

4、Reliability and Durability: Choose a PLC controller that is reliable and built to last. Look for systems with a proven track record of performance and durability in similar applications.

5、Support and Training: Consider the availability of support and training resources for the PLC controller you choose. This will ensure that you can get help when needed and maximize the efficiency of your system.
